Animal Lovers Club Visits Catsanova

The Animal Lovers Club of Mahidol University International College (MUIC) organized a trip to Catsanova, an adoptable cat cafe located in Bangkok, on March 8, 2024.

As a result, the 15 participating students were able to learn much about cats and were able to get an idea of the size of the stray cat population in Thailand. Since the cafe was small, participants were divided into three groups and went to go see the cats in rounds while the other two groups had lunch.

This activity was meant to spread awareness about the cat population and hopefully to dispel misconceptions about how cats do not need as much attention or care as dogs. The visit to Catsanova allowed students who were considering to adopt a cat to be able to experience and understand the requirements and basic steps of care required for a new pet cat.

It was also a relaxing activity for the students who wanted to wind down from their midterm exams by spending time in a small cafe with adorable companions.
